+package org.opendaylight.controller.model.util;\r
+\r
+import java.math.BigDecimal;\r
+import java.util.ArrayList;\r
+import java.util.Collections;\r
+import java.util.List;\r
+\r
+import org.opendaylight.controller.model.api.type.DecimalTypeDefinition;\r
+import org.opendaylight.controller.model.api.type.RangeConstraint;\r
+import org.opendaylight.controller.yang.common.QName;\r
+import org.opendaylight.controller.yang.model.api.ExtensionDefinition;\r
+import org.opendaylight.controller.yang.model.api.SchemaPath;\r
+import org.opendaylight.controller.yang.model.api.Status;\r
+\r
+public class Decimal64 implements DecimalTypeDefinition {\r
+\r
+ private final QName name = BaseTypes.constructQName("decimal64");\r
+ private final SchemaPath path;\r
+ private String units = "";\r
+ private BigDecimal defaultValue = null;\r
+\r
+ private final String description = "The decimal64 type represents a subset of the real numbers, which can "\r
+ + "be represented by decimal numerals. The value space of decimal64 is the set of numbers that can "\r
+ + "be obtained by multiplying a 64-bit signed integer by a negative power of ten, i.e., expressible as "\r
+ + "'i x 10^-n' where i is an integer64 and n is an integer between 1 and 18, inclusively.";\r
+\r
+ private final String reference = "https://tools.ietf.org/html/rfc6020#section-9.3";\r
+\r
+ private final List<RangeConstraint> rangeStatements;\r
+ private final Integer fractionDigits;\r
+\r
+ public Decimal64(final Integer fractionDigits) {\r
+ super();\r
+ this.fractionDigits = fractionDigits;\r
+ rangeStatements = new ArrayList<RangeConstraint>();\r
+ this.path = BaseTypes.schemaPath(name);\r
+ }\r
+\r
+ public Decimal64(final List<RangeConstraint> rangeStatements,\r
+ Integer fractionDigits) {\r
+ super();\r
+ this.rangeStatements = rangeStatements;\r
+ this.fractionDigits = fractionDigits;\r
+ this.path = BaseTypes.schemaPath(name);\r
+ }\r
+\r
+ public Decimal64(final String units, final BigDecimal defaultValue,\r
+ final List<RangeConstraint> rangeStatements,\r
+ final Integer fractionDigits) {\r
+ super();\r
+ this.units = units;\r
+ this.defaultValue = defaultValue;\r
+ this.rangeStatements = rangeStatements;\r
+ this.fractionDigits = fractionDigits;\r
+ this.path = BaseTypes.schemaPath(name);\r
+ }\r
+\r
+ @Override\r
+ public DecimalTypeDefinition getBaseType() {\r
+ return this;\r
+ }\r
+\r
+ @Override\r
+ public String getUnits() {\r
+ return units;\r
+ }\r
+\r
+ @Override\r
+ public Object getDefaultValue() {\r
+ return defaultValue;\r
+ }\r
+\r
+ @Override\r
+ public QName getQName() {\r
+ return name;\r
+ }\r
+\r
+ @Override\r
+ public SchemaPath getPath() {\r
+ return path;\r
+ }\r
+\r
+ @Override\r
+ public String getDescription() {\r
+ return description;\r
+ }\r
+\r
+ @Override\r
+ public String getReference() {\r
+ return reference;\r
+ }\r
+\r
+ @Override\r
+ public Status getStatus() {\r
+ return Status.CURRENT;\r
+ }\r
+\r
+ @Override\r
+ public List<ExtensionDefinition> getExtensionSchemaNodes() {\r
+ return Collections.emptyList();\r
+ }\r
+\r
+ @Override\r
+ public List<RangeConstraint> getRangeStatements() {\r
+ return rangeStatements;\r
+ }\r
+\r
+ @Override\r
+ public Integer getFractionDigits() {\r
+ return fractionDigits;\r
+ }\r
+\r
+ @Override\r
+ public String toString() {\r
+ return Decimal64.class.getSimpleName() + "[qname=" + name\r
+ + ", fractionDigits=" + fractionDigits + "]";\r
+ }\r
+}\r
